New Delhi, June 30 The Influencer Marketing industry has witnessed a huge rise in the past 2 years and continues to grow at a rapid pace. In the midst of this flourishing and growing industry, businesses would often offer free gifts and deal in barter collaborations with influencers in exchange for getting promotions for their product/service. However, the recent taxation policy announced by the Indian Government is about to change all that .

As per the provision introduced in the Finance Act 2022, section 194R mandates a 10 per cent tax deducted at source
